    A cross wall
    Leon W.

    My daughter and I ate lunch at this El Chaparral in Boerne, TX and the lunch was great, the restaurant is very nice and the decor was superb. Our waiter, Brian was attentive, offered suggestions for dessert, was friendly and gave us a brief history of this El Chaparral in Boerne, TX I ordered the puffy taco plate with carne Guisada and the tacos were great especially the puffy corn tortillas. My daughter ordered the chicken nachos and the little corn tortilla cup with guacamole was so cute! My daughter ordered churo bites with caramel sauce for dessert RECOMMEDATION: I would definitely return to El Chaparral in Boerne, TX for another lunch outing or dinner.

    Chicken enchiladas with cilantro cream sauce (beans missing because I'm allergic)
    Staci A.

    We've been to the location in Helotes many times over the years...have been to the Boerne location a few times. They are both great for larger parties and both have nice outside seating...very spacious dining inside and out. Both locations have a nice bar area, as well. Today I had what I most often have...chicken enchiladas with cilantro cream sauce. The plate also comes with beans and rice, but I'm allergic to beans so leave them off. Frozen margaritas are so yummy! And their salsa is really delicious. I pour it all over my rice and enchiladas! Service was a little slow...and we were there in the middle of the afternoon, so it wasn't busy. Had to ask several times for water and a couple other things. But she had a warm smile and we weren't in a hurry, so not a deal breaker. *Bonus - they offer a military discount!

    James F.

    GF and I don't visit Boerne too often. Not exactly sure why but we just go elsewhere. Charming downtown with fun (also expensive) shopping and people watching. While the available restaurants are good it's lacking a good Tex-Mex option. I also do have to point out that too many restaurants are closing in Boerne. I follow My San Antonio and local closings are staggering. Now, some good news on a recent trip. We were looking at trucks at the local "motor mile" and stumbled onto El Chaparral. Restaurants aren't always on Main Street folks. We found El Chaparral by taking backroads to visit car dealerships. Praise for their tenure in the town we sat down for lunch on the first visit. Chips and salsa starts your experience. Then, bean soup! The most flavorful borracho/charro beans in all of Texas. Did Lupe Tortilla steal this? The server explained we had the option to sub them on an entree instead of refried or similar less seasoned "charro beans". WHY???? Those beans are perfect! As I said two visits. First entree was my requisite shrimp enchiladas. Can't remember when I've had the dish paired with a sour cream sauce. Shrimp were well seasoned with grilled onion. Sauce was too heavy on the sour cream and zero seasoning. Next visit I went with a taco salad. This is my second go to and again found issues with the dish. Shredded chicken was tasty; artful presentation with the toppings. But, tortilla bowl is not hot. Cold in fact. No crispy love there which makes the dish an indulgence for me. I'll be back for the beans.

    Mango margarita
    Don J.

    Good margaritas, friendly service and delicious Mexican dinners. Seating options include al fresco on the patio, a lively bar area or indoor tables. Puffy tacos, a San Antonio tradition, are done nicely here - perfectly puffy taco shells, loaded with hearty picadillo filling, arrived hot and upright on a stainless steel taco stand that kept everything from spilling out. I'm usually a fan of breaded and fried cheese chile rellenos, but the grilled Cristina's version stuffed with jalapeño chicken filling was a nice change-up. This location is a little easier to get into on a Friday night than the original location in Helotes.
